
Abuja, Nigeria — SocioAfrica has issued a strong warning for greater integrity, transparency, and accountability within Nigeria’s financial and technology sectors, emphasizing that unlawful tampering with customers’ accounts or personal data constitutes a serious threat to national and digital security.
The organization stressed that banks, fintech companies, and IT service providers have a moral and legal responsibility to uphold the highest standards of data privacy and financial ethics.
“No citizen should ever wake up to find their account frozen or manipulated without lawful reason or due process,” said Oluwaseun Medayedupin, Founder of SocioAfrica. “Financial integrity is a pillar of national trust — protecting it is protecting the nation itself.”
💡 Financial Integrity as a National Security Priority
SocioAfrica is urging the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N), Nigerian Financial Intelligence Unit (NFIU), and other regulatory agencies to strengthen oversight of financial and IT operations — especially as digital transactions dominate the modern economy.
Key Recommendations Include:
- Establishing strict penalties for unlawful account interference.
 - Enhancing inter-agency cooperation between financial regulators and cybersecurity units.
 - Introducing AI-driven monitoring systems to detect and prevent data breaches.
 - Launching a national awareness campaign on digital rights and consumer protection.
 
“Data and money are the lifeblood of modern society. Tampering with either is not just unethical — it destabilizes trust, business, and national progress,” Medayedupin added.
🌍 Protecting Citizens, Restoring Trust
SocioAfrica calls on all banks and IT companies to adopt transparent customer communication practices, immediate grievance redress mechanisms, and independent audit systems to prevent abuse of digital power.
The organization also reaffirmed its readiness to collaborate with regulatory bodies, cybersecurity agencies, and global financial institutions to build a digital ecosystem rooted in ethics, justice, and accountability.
